Hey u guys in america.
Today i was riding (not a atv) but a spyder from Can-Am. Its legal to drive this things on the road in Norway.
I only make this thread to brag :) This is a nice way to get from a to b or just have fun crusing around. I needed to try the speed of this, and i had 120 mile on it, and it was rock solid on the road. Im wondering maybe i should change my 4 wheeler in for this bike. (im using my 4wheeler only on the road)
Has anyone else tryed this spyder?

Runar
